×
Register Here to Apply for Jobs or Post Jobs. X

CNC Programmer - Aerospace

Job in Livonia, Wayne County, Michigan, 48153, USA
Listing for: Héroux-Devtek
Full Time position
Listed on 2026-03-08
Job specializations:
  • Manufacturing / Production
    Manufacturing Engineer
  • Engineering
    Manufacturing Engineer
Salary/Wage Range or Industry Benchmark: 80000 - 100000 USD Yearly USD 80000.00 100000.00 YEAR
Job Description & How to Apply Below

Heroux-Devtek, the world’s 3rd largest producer of landing gear, serves the civil and military aerospace markets from production facilities in North America, Europe and United Kingdom. The Company’s longevity, flexibility, and track record for the development and implementation of innovative production systems have distinguished it as a leader in the domain. With its most recent acquisitions, Heroux-Devtek is bolstering its status as one of the foremost landing gear, actuation and hydraulic system designers and manufacturers in the global aerospace industry.

Information

On The Division

Located in Livonia, Michigan, spanning 3 facilities (100,000+ sq. ft.) with over 130 employees, Beaver Aerospace & Defense is one of Héroux-Devtek’s centers of excellence for design, development, manufacturing, and assembly of ball screws, actuation systems and other aerospace components.

Our ball screws, ball splines, gears, and electromechanical linear/rotary actuators are custom designed to fit virtually any application with superior performance, quality and precision. In fact, our actuation solutions are installed on some of the most advanced aircraft, missile applications and mission‑critical space exploration systems in the world, featuring the latest in motion control technology.

With a strong focus on custom precision manufacturing processes with machining automation and techniques, we aim to remain the best value producer of complex and precision Aerospace & Defense components.

What we offer?
  • Leaders who invest in your success, development, and growth
  • A culture of true teamwork and pride in our product
  • Competitive salaries linked to performance and paid time off
  • 9 paid holidays
  • A comprehensive group insurance plan including a HSA/FSA options, Dental & Vision
  • Coverage for Domestic Partnerships
  • Supportive wellness program, including healthcare discounts
  • Automatic Life Insurance with supplemental options
  • Short- and Long-Term Disability Insurance
  • Opportunities for retirement savings with 401k plans including a company match
  • Tuition reimbursement for relevant Certifications, Education, & Trainings
  • Free access to a virtual doctor and the employee assistance program
  • Social activities for all employees (BBQ, Golf, Christmas parties, etc.)
  • Generous referral bonuses and advantageous recognition programs
  • A motivating work environment and a human management style where you can make a difference
Main Responsibilities CNC Programming & Process Development
  • Develop, optimize, and maintain CNC programs for multi‑axis machining centers using CATIA V5 and related programming software.
  • Prepare solid models and geometry for toolpath generation, plan machining strategy, sequencing, and process flow.
  • Generate and issue complete program packages, including tool lists, setup sheets, and inspection/measuring tool requirements.
  • Convert and adapt CNC programs for alternate machining centers as required.
  • Process and implement program revisions and engineering change requests; maintain accurate documentation control.
Verification & Validation
  • Verify toolpaths with the use of Vericut simulation software to ensure collision avoidance and process integrity.
  • Perform tape‑proving and on‑machine validation of CNC programs.
  • Review and archive returned program packages in accordance with document control procedures.
Manufacturing Support & Continuous Improvement
  • Investigate and resolve manufacturing issues related to CNC programming, tooling, fixturing, and machining methods.
  • Collaborate with Manufacturing Engineering on process improvements, fixture design, and method optimization.
  • Identify tooling requirements, support initial procurement, and test new tooling solutions.
  • Troubleshoot machining processes to improve efficiency, quality, and throughput.
  • Participate in Lean, 6S, and Continuous Improvement initiatives.
Additional Responsibilities
  • Perform other duties as assigned in support of production and operational objectives.
Our Ideal Candidate
  • Post‑secondary technical diploma, certificate or degree. Minimum 2 years’ experience as a CNC programmer using multi axis applications or minimum 5 years’ experience operating CNC machines, preferably in the aerospace industry.
  • Profi…
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ary